Cost of Living Summary

Dining and Restaurants
  • Inexpensive Restaurant MealA meal at a casual restaurant will typically cost $4.97 on average, with a range between $0.43 and $7.09.
  • Mid-Range Restaurant (Three-Course Meal for Two)For a more upscale dining experience, expect to pay around $63.47, with prices ranging from $28.37 to $84.63.
  • Fast Food (e.g., McDonald's)A McMeal or equivalent combo meal averages $6.35, with a range between $5.5 and $6.38.
  • Beverages (e.g., Domestic Beer, Imported Beer, Cappuccino, Coke/Pepsi)Domestic beer ranges from $1.77 to $4.26, imported beer $2.84 to $4.23, cappuccino $1.06 to $3.17, and Coke/Pepsi $0.71 to $3.17.
Grocery Prices
  • MilkMilk is priced between $1.13 and $1.77 per liter, averaging $1.39.
  • Bread (Loaf of Fresh White Bread)A loaf of fresh white bread costs between $0.14 and $1.06, with an average price of $0.66.
  • Eggs (Dozen)A dozen eggs range from $1.65 to $2.47, averaging $2.02.
  • Fruits (e.g., Apples, Oranges)Apples cost $1.42 to $2.84 per kg, while oranges range from $1.42 to $2.13 per kg.
  • Vegetables (e.g., Potatoes, Lettuce)Potatoes are priced between $0.71 and $1.06 per kg, and lettuce costs $0.14 to $0.35 per head.
Transportation
  • Public Transport (One-Way Ticket)A one-way local transport ticket costs between $0.14 and $0.35.
  • Fuel (Gasoline)Gasoline is priced between $0.85 and $1.16 per liter.
  • Taxi FaresTaxi fares start at $0.35, with a cost of $0.71 per km and $2.84 to $5.67 per hour of waiting.
Housing Costs
  • 1-Bedroom Apartment Rent (City Centre)Rent for a 1-bedroom apartment in the city centre averages $102.56.
  • 1-Bedroom Apartment Rent (Outside Centre)Outside the centre, rent ranges from $22.22 to $85.11, averaging $53.66.
  • 3-Bedroom Apartment Rent (City Centre)Rent for a 3-bedroom apartment in the city centre averages $226.95.
  • 3-Bedroom Apartment Rent (Outside Centre)Outside the centre, rent averages $141.84.
  • Buying Price per Square Meter (City Centre)The price per square meter to buy an apartment in the city centre averages $1450.43.
  • Buying Price per Square Meter (Outside Centre)Outside the centre, the price per square meter averages $1150.55.
Utilities
  • Basic Utilities (Electricity, Heating, Water, etc.)Basic utilities for an 85m2 apartment cost between $21.28 and $42.55, averaging $31.91.
  • InternetInternet services range from $35.46 to $70.92, with an average cost of $47.28.
